1:32 So there’s different kinds of cognitive and memory loss that occur with aging.
1:35 Certain kinds of memory loss, such as forgetting where your car keys are
1:38 are part of the normal process of getting older.
1:41 And in fact, memory peaks surprisingly early at the age
1:43 of 30 and then declines gradually with time.
1:46 If you forget where your glasses are, that's normal memory loss.
1:49 If you forget the fact that you wear glasses, that's dementia.
1:52 It's not well understood exactly what physically underlies this.
1:56 Although plausible candidates are loss of the brain's ability to form new
2:00 connections or to easily modulate the weight
2:03 of the connections between nerve cells, those are called synaptic weights.
2:06 And so those would be candidates for why the brain seems
2:08 to be less plastic in certain ways as we get older.
2:11 You can look in the brains of people who,
2:13 after death, are diagnosed as having Alzheimer's disease,
2:15 and they have plaques and tangles that appear to be
2:18 either the causes of cell death or perhaps the residue,
2:21 the aftermath of cell death.
2:23 One of the best things you can do to keep your brain
2:25 alive and healthy is simply improving blood flow to the brain.
2:29 Another major mechanism that's been suggested is the secretion
2:32 of a signaling molecule called brain derived neurotrophic factor.
2:36 It's a factor that's made in the brain that causes neurons to grow.
2:41 And that factor has been demonstrated to improve plasticity in dendrites.
2:44 The idea that exercise, by triggering the secretion of BDNF,
2:49 this neurotrophic factor,
2:50 may lead to increased plasticity and improved brain function.

3:17 The biggest problems are not so much with long-term memories,
3:20 but really the short-term memories.
3:22 So we can remember our first kiss when we were in high
3:26 school but we may not remember what we had for lunch.
3:29 And because we have shrinking of the brain brain cells
3:33 actually start to function less efficiently and do die over time.
3:38 The connections between the brain cells diminish
3:42 and the neurochemical transmitters seem to have problems.
3:47 So all of those kinds of physiological changes
3:49 contribute to problems with memory as we age.
3:52 And what happens is that memory is basically
3:55 stored in little neurochemical packets in the brain.
3:58 So they can be changed and our memories can deceive us very often.
4:03 It's actually possible to improve our memory
4:07 ability with relatively simple strategies and techniques.
4:10 I often recommend that people find things that they prefer personally.
4:15 Things that are mentally challenging but not too difficult.
4:18 So the point is to train but not strain the brain.
4:21 Whether it's crossword puzzles, learning languages, playing musical instruments.
4:25 It's important to try out different things
4:28 and do what works for you and what's enjoyable.
4:34 Here’s why there's hope for everybody
4:37 and that is the principle of brain plasticity.
4:41 Brain plasticity is this idea that the brain
4:45 has an extraordinary capacity to change or modify
4:49 its wiring based on the environment that you
4:53 put the brain in, including the physical environment.
4:56 Are you walking a lot?
4:57 Are you running?
4:58 Are you keeping yourself physically active?
5:01 These result in what I call positive brain plasticity.
5:05 What is the difference between a sedentary
5:08 brain and an active brain of a runner?
5:11 Well, the runner's brain has higher levels of dopamine and serotonin
5:16 boosted every single time that runner goes for a run.
5:19 It elevates general mood state.
5:23 Studies that I did in my lab showed that people that went to three months
5:28 of spin class had overall higher mood states
5:31 than people for three months who played video Scrabble.
5:35 Those people in the exercise group also have
5:38 much more growth factors going through their brain.
5:41 I like to think of it like a watering
5:43 can of growth factors all up and down your hippocampi.
5:46 What's happening?
5:48 They’re growing, popping shiny new hippocampal cells
5:51 and they're making their prefrontal cortex work better.
5:54 But again, everything is fluid with brain plasticity.
5:58 Even if you've been sedentary all your life,
6:01 you can start moving towards what I like to call bigger,
6:05 fatter, fluffier and happier brain with just ten minutes of walking.
6:10 We found the same kind of benefits.
6:12 Better mood, decreased anxiety, depression levels and better focus.
6:17 Physical activity is the most transformative thing that you could do,
6:22 not only for your body but for your brain as well.
